I had bootcamp at 5:00a, it was a hard upper body work out, but I am getting used to this and as hard as it is, I am loving it. I love getting up at 4:20 and getting my work out in and then heading up to hike/run with friends in the mountains.

This morning I picked up Ardath at 6:30 and we drove to the Upper Millcreek parking lot, when we got out of the car it was 49 degrees, when we got back to the car it was 58 degrees.  It is shady on the Great Western and Dog Lake trails.  I think the Pipeline is too exposed for the heat we have now, so our plan to stay high was perfect.  We had a great time, not anywhere near the foot/bike traffic we had on Sat.  By the time we got home, at 9:30 it was 78 degreees. I would not want to hike or run in that much heat.  I am lucky to have the mountains in my backyard.
